Our Mission
Our mission at Eden’s Way Farm Sanctuary is to provide a loving lifelong safe haven to rescued, surrendered, and abandoned farm animals.
We strive to create a safe, spacious, and peaceful farm setting to promote our resident’s healing, well-being, and flourishing. We also aim to create an inclusive farm sanctuary community for people too – where visitors from all ages and backgrounds can connect with animals, experience their calming and therapeutic effects, and be inspired to make more compassionate choices towards them.
We are a volunteer run, registered charity organization in Kamloops, British Columbia, Canada that offers a forever home for rescued, surrendered, and abandoned farmed animals. The Sanctuary was founded in July, 2019 and received registered charity status in 2022, and it is funded solely by kind people who care about farm animals.
We currently care for over 60 residents including cows, horses, goats, sheep, pigs, chickens, ducks, turkies, peafowl, and rabbits.


Our Story
Eden’s Way Farm Sanctuary began as a dream for its found, Jaye Dueck, who has deeply cared for animals since her childhood growing up on a ranch in Northern Alberta. Although, life led her into a different world of city living, academia, and a career as a psychologist, her heart increasingly longed to return to a farm where she could establish an animal sanctuary.
In July 2019, this seemingly impossible dream came true,when she and her husband, Murray Dueck, purchased and moved to a beautiful 20-acre hobby farm nestled between the South Thompson-River and sage-filled hills in Kamloops, BC.
Within, their first week on the farm, they saved 2 horses and 2 dairy calves and since then have slowly grown, rescuing several farm animals from dairy cattle to rabbits. In September 2020, the sanctuary became a registered non-profit organization.
Since that time, the sanctuary has grown – both in rescuing more animals and developing educational programs and activities for the community. On February 2, 2022, Eden’s Way Farm Sanctuary was privileged to receive designation as a Registered Charitable Organization in Canada.
